Interview: Austin Abbott
Title: Mr. Austin Abbott (1890?-) : Mining, lumbering, Indians [sound recording] : a tape recorded interview by Rex Strommes : / Austin Abbott.
Interviewee: Abbott, Austin
Recording Location: Cedar Ridge, CA
Date Recorded: November 28, 1972

General Notes: Contents outline (typescript, photocopy) includes a handwritten account "personal observations on Tuolumne County" accompanies recording.
Contents: Introduction (November 28, 1972) -- Present day occupations (December 5, 1972): Cedar Ridge Water Works, Apple orchard ; Family: Grandfather moved here in 1850 from New York--Father died young, Mined in Columbia, Moved to present site of Abbott Ranch -- Mining: Placer mining--Hydraulic, Water, Columbia, More money put in than taken out ; Pocket mining: Quartz mines, Equipment (picks, dynamite, drills) ; Water source: Mules, Canals, Dams, Changed from mining to electricity (PG&E) ; Mines: Jumper Mine, Eagle Mine, Confidence Mine (7,000,000 dollars), Molones Mine, Stamps (size), Assaying (tests for gold), Mine fire (22 killed) -- Lumber: Furnished timber for mines--Cuen Mill (Abbott was foreman), Timber used for support ; Building--Pinecrest and Twain Harte ; Age of timber--75 to 100 years ; Replanting--Didn't replant in earlier days (grew as well) -- Lumber: How wood was hauled ; Oxen and mule teams ; Roads--fFrom Sonora up ; Logging now and then--Methods, Bucking, Chokers ; Lumberhacks--Where they came from, How they lived -- Indians: Where they lived ; Twain Harte-Ball Rock--Small houses ; Mi-Woks--Diggers ; Chief Fuller--Worked for Abbott's father, Head man of Mi-Woks ; Spanish flue wiped them out--1908, Mixed with other races ; Frank Dick--Only real Indian around, Yosemite tribe -- Apple growing -- Characters.
